Raduza
'V hore
(MAM260-2)
Musicians:
Raduza - voice, accordion, various instruments
with:
František Raba - double-bass, violin
Omar Khaouj - guitar
Ivanka Pokorná - harp
Label - Indies Records, Czech Rep
Released 2005
Immediately after its release in April,
the new album of RADUZA, „V hore“, was among the best selling CDs in the Czech Republic.
From record label:
"During February and March [2005], Raduza was spending her time isolated in the studio and recorded new songs. Besides them, she recorded songs that one can hear
in her live concerts. This way she created 21 tracks – everything took place in the music studio Largo in Prague.
František Raba from the band KOA took charge of the sound direction. On the new album, „V hore“, naturally a few interesting guests took part – for example the guitarist from KOA,
Omar Khaouj, above mentioned František Raba with his double-bass and violin, or
Ivanka Pokorná with her harp. The sleeve of the CD was, similarly as with the preceding album, designed by
Richard Procházka...
...The pieces oscillate from chanson through reggae towards inspiration by folk or classical music. The whole compilation is floating on the waves of high and low tide. Like this, it is able to lead our senses into the sad places of our soul, to swirl them suddenly with an unexpected and
sophisticated music drive."
